100% Cure Rate Pancreatic Cancer Experimental Study Animal Model
A research team reports that combining a type of radiation therapy with immunotherapy not only cures pancreatic cancer in mice, but appears to reprogram the immune system to create an ‘immune memory’ in the same way that a vaccine keeps the flu away. The result is that the combination treatment also destroyed pancreatic cells that had spread to the liver, a common site for metastatic disease.

Bradley N. Mills, Kelli A. Connolly, Jian Ye, Joseph D. Murphy, Taylor P. Uccello, Booyeon J. Han, Tony Zhao, Michael G. Drage, Aditi Murthy, Haoming Qiu, Ankit Patel, Nathania M. Figueroa, Carl J. Johnston, Peter A. Prieto, Nejat K. Egilmez, Brian A. Belt, Edith M. Lord, David C. Linehan, Scott A. Gerber. Stereotactic Body Radiation and Interleukin-12 Combination Therapy Eradicates Pancreatic Tumors by Repolarizing the Immune Microenvironment. Cell Reports, 2019; 29 (2): 406 DOI: 10.1016/j.celrep.2019.08.095
